Crynodeb
The postholder will manage the Artistic Director's diary, meetings, travel, and occasional correspondence. They will also provide general administrative support to the wider Production team through coordinating team meetings, taking notes and actions during meetings, and organising artist travel and accommodation.

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
Artistic Director Administration: manage the Artistic Director's diary, including booking meetings, travel and accommodation; draw up itineraries and schedules for business trips and site visits; process the Artistic Director's expenses each month.
Production Team Support: Coordinate and attend internal production meetings, producing agendas and notes to circulate to attendees; ensure all contact details for suppliers, artists and contractors are logged on our internal CRM database; organise artist travel and accommodation for site visits and project delivery.
Financial Support: manage delegated areas of budget, if directed; manage paperwork relating to production expenses and pass on to the Finance department for payment.
Research and Reporting: manage and collate information and data relating to sustainability monitoring; undertake research to assist with the development of future projects as requested.
